내 마음 속에 잠들어 있는
토이
This is one of the most interior songs in the 토이 catalog — a track that seems to exist entirely in the middle distance of memory, the emotional space where things you thought you'd moved past turn out to be still alive and waiting. The production is immaculate in the way 유희열's arrangements consistently are: every element earning its place, a gentle jazz-tinged harmonic language beneath the surface, rhythm that breathes rather than drives. The melody has a certain soft inevitability to it, lines that resolve in ways that feel earned rather than predictable. The vocal performance is measured and precise, emotion carried through timbre and phrasing rather than volume or climax. The core of the song is the uncomfortable discovery of something dormant in yourself — a feeling, a person, a version of who you were — suddenly awake and demanding acknowledgment. It belongs to the sophisticated Korean pop tradition of the mid-90s that trusted its audience to sit with ambiguity, music that didn't need to resolve into catharsis. This is a late-night song, best heard alone, when something you haven't thought about in years surfaces without warning.
